Without a shadow of a doubt, accomplished and talented individuals are of the essence, especially when it comes to going toward a flourishing society. An unanswered question in this area is whether allocating public funding to upgrade young adults' skills is economically efficient. Although some arguments assert that government should not involve in these programs and let people realize what skills are required for their occupations, I believe otherwise, maintaining that governments should provide enough money to update job-related skills. In the following paragraphs, I will elaborate on my viewpoint through two compelling reasons.
The first exquisite point corroborating my stance on this subject is improving prospective job candidates’ skills prevents squandering time and money. Whether in public sectors or private sectors, many incompetent staff waste financial resources. Even though these people have strong credentials, their knowledge is obsolete due to the sharp growth of technology. Some giant corporations have held training classes for both experienced and new employees annually, and they could increase the productivity and performance of their clerks. Also, they satisfied their customers and won the business competition. If the government widely implements the same policy, the country’s economy will thrive and increase the quality of life in the light of economic growth.
Another reason to be mentioned is that those people who are familiar with technology are less likely to struggle with their children. Given the necessity of nascent technologies like social media and the Internet in daily life, children easily access them and are vulnerable to their adverse effects. If parents protect their kids from the dark side of the Internet and social media, they will expose to inappropriate age-contend. As a result, juvenile delinquency and anti-social behavior will be increased in society. If governments improve the technology-based knowledge of future parents, they will monitor their children appropriately, so government decreases their expenditure on dealing with crimes and illegal activities. Additionally, teaching these skills to their children reduces government spending on education. For example, had I not acquired computer skills, I would have faced a challenge for my kid’s education during Covid-19.
Reflecting upon the grounds mentioned above, one soon realizes government should spare no expense in teaching modern skills nor begrudge any penny spent.
